Talent Management Specialist develops, implements, and administers programs that evaluate, measure, and improve employee performance. Conducts assessment activities to evaluate and identify the current and emerging skills, competencies, and behaviors required to achieve desired organizational results and prepare for future needs. Being a Talent Management Specialist designs performance management strategies and processes that measure outcomes, identify areas for improvement, and align teams to organizational goals. Identifies the types of training and development and resources needed to achieve workforce performance improvements. Additionally, Talent Management Specialist encourages a culture of objective setting and result measurement aligned to pay and rewards using tools, training, and communication.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. The Talent Management Specialist occ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. Gaining ex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. To be a Talent Management Specialist typically requires 2-4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    The Director of Talent Management will play a pivotal role in developing and implementing strategies to attract, retain, and develop top talent within our organization. You will lead a team dedicated to building world-class talent programs that cultivate a high-performing, growth-minded culture and an employee experience that employees view as the best time of their careers. Your responsibilities will encompass leadership of programs across talent management, including performance enablement, employee listening, employee learning and development, and strategic talent assessment and planning.  

    Responsibilities:
    Use data-driven insights and industry best practices to design, optimize and execute talent management processes in the following areas:

    • Performance Enablement
      • Spearhead the design and implementation of performance enablement systems, processes, and tools to drive individual and organizational performance excellence
      • Design programs and lead team to provide strategic guidance and support to managers and employees on setting OKRs (objectives and key results), providing feedback, and addressing performance issues
      • Analyze performance data to identify trends, strengths, and areas for improvement and develop actionable insights to enhance overall performance
    • Employee Listening
      • Lead the development of strategies to effectively measure, summarize, and enhance the Freshworks employee experience
      • Design and implement regular surveys and assessments to measure employee engagement and identify opportunities for improvement
      •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to address employee concerns, improve the work environment, and promote a culture of high performance, recognition, inclusivity, and belonging where employees are empowered to do their best work
    • Learning and Development
      • Develop and lead a team to execute a comprehensive learning and development strategy that aligns to our core global programs, focused on company objectives and employee growth needs and a lens on operationalizing and building rigor
      • Design and implement an integrated approach to development across the talent management function, including training programs, workshops, and resources to support employee development and career growth
      • Evaluate the effectiveness of learning initiatives and adjust strategies as needed to ensure alignment with organizational goals and employee needs 
    • Strategic Talent Assessment and Planning
      • Design and implement talent assessment e.g., calibration and succession planning, processes to identify and develop high-potential talent for key roles within the organization
      • Work closely with leadership, partner COEs and within talent management to assess current and future talent needs and design a process that will build robust talent pipelines
      • Develop and implement tools and practices to increase the adoption of key talent practices and talent development plans to prepare employees for future leadership roles to ensure the continuity of critical functions

    Qualifications

    •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Industrial Organizational Psychology, Business Administration, or a related field; Master’s degree preferred
    • Proven experience (15 years) in talent management, HR Leadership, or related roles
    • Strong understanding of talent management principles, practices, and trends
    • Excellent interpersonal, communication, facilitation and leadership skills
    • Demonstrated ability to build and maintain effective relationships with stakeholders at all levels
    • Strategic thinker with the ability to translate vision into actionable plans and initiatives
    • Strong analytical skills with the ability to leverage data to drive insights and decision-making
    • Agile and curious leader with experience working in a fast-paced, rapidly changing environment and a willingness to be involved in programs from conception to execution

San Francisco is located on the West Coast of the United States at the north end of the San Francisco Peninsula and includes significant stretches of the Pacific Ocean and San Francisco Bay within its boundaries. Several picturesque islands—Alcatraz, Treasure Island and the adjacent Yerba Buena Island, and small portions of Alameda Island, Red Rock Island, and Angel Island—are part of the city. Also included are the uninhabited Farallon Islands, 27 miles (43 km) offshore in the Pacific Ocean.
